ERC can support UST and AST testing, removal, waste handling, excavation, backfill, and closure-related field work for appropriate Illinois projects. Tank size, contents, accessibility, soil conditions, and required documentation should be reviewed before mobilization.

ERC employees supporting environmental remediation receive 40-hour HAZWOPER training and annual refreshers, along with training that may include RCRA, DOT, confined-space entry, respiratory protection, First Aid and CPR, and project-specific requirements. The field plan also addresses hazards and controls identified for the individual site.
